There is a known issue causing mod mismatch errors or servers to not be visible due to Structures+. Ark updated the game client on the 20th October with changes to mod files for S+ causing a conflict overall with the mod and client files with affected users.

There are steps to resolve it and it's been discussed at length on the S+ mod page.

The steps to follow generally follow our standard guidance on cleanly uninstalling all mods on the client side but its only required to do S+ in this case: https://help.serverblend.com/en/article/how-to-uninstall-your-ark-mods-client-side-1yepnj8/ 

 

These are client-side steps, not server-side.

  • Close the game
  • Unsub from the Structures+ mod from the Steam client on your PC. (Server should be visible straight away in-game). 
  • Delete the files for it Structures+ by going to ARK\ShooterGame\Content\Mods** and delete the directory/folder "731604991" and the "731604991.mod" file on your PC. (Not the server).
  • Delete the workshop stored file in the download area by going to SteamLibrary\steamapps\workshop\content\346110** and deleting the directory/folder "731604991" and the "731604991.mod" file
  • Resub to the mod or load the game and join your server and let it download the mod, which will re-subscribe you to the mod. (May time out depending on download speed/disk speed just join again).
  • Let it load mods and join.

If in doubt uninstall S+ on the server and install to grab new files but the server-side files were not touched as no update released for the servers. It is vital all gamers joining your servers run these steps if you use structures+ as this is a client-side issue. 

**Paths above will vary based on your installation paths.
